15 The Citadel, Castlecrag is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ces. The property has a land size of 816m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2023.
Why you'll love it:
One of the most celebrated early 20th century houses in Australia, this unique Walter Burley Griffin home captures picturesque Middle Harbour views from a landscaped 809sqm parcel. It's a stroll to Sydney CBD/North Sydney/Chatswood buses, close to village shops and cafes.

The size of Castlecrag is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 16 parks covering nearly 18.9% of total area. The population of Castlecrag in 2016 was 2939 people. By 2021 the population was 2965 showing a population growth of 0.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Castlecrag is 10-19 years. Households in Castlecrag are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Castlecrag work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 87.10% of the homes in Castlecrag were owner-occupied compared with 85.50% in 2016.
